然而,在某些特定场景下,我们可能仍然需要使用到已经退役的Windows XP系统
这时,虚拟机技术便成为了一个高效、便捷且经济的解决方案
本文将深入探讨在虚拟机中安装Windows XP的优势、步骤以及注意事项,帮助读者充分利用旧系统资源,满足多样化的应用需求
一、虚拟机技术的优势 虚拟机(Virtual Machine, VM)是一种通过软件模拟的具有完整硬件系统功能的、运行在一个完全隔离环境中的计算机系统
它允许用户在同一台物理机上同时运行多个操作系统,且这些操作系统之间互不干扰
在虚拟机中安装Windows XP,具有以下显著优势: 1.资源利用高效:虚拟机能够动态分配CPU、内存、磁盘空间等资源给各个虚拟机实例,确保资源得到最大化利用
这意味着,即使你的物理机配置不高,也能通过合理配置虚拟机资源,流畅运行Windows XP
2.隔离性与安全性:虚拟机提供了一个独立的运行环境,使得Windows XP系统内的应用与物理机上的其他系统和应用完全隔离
这大大降低了病毒、恶意软件跨系统传播的风险,提升了整体系统的安全性
3.便捷性与灵活性:虚拟机软件通常提供快照、克隆等功能,用户可以轻松备份、恢复或复制虚拟机状态,极大地方便了系统管理和测试工作
此外,虚拟机还支持在不同物理机间迁移,提高了系统的灵活性和可用性
4.兼容性保障:尽管Windows XP已经停止官方支持,但仍有大量老旧软件、游戏或硬件设备仅能在Windows XP环境下运行
通过虚拟机技术,我们可以在不影响当前主流系统使用的前提下,继续保留对这些老旧资源的支持
二、虚拟机软件的选择 市面上有多款流行的虚拟机软件可供选择,如VMware Workstation、Oracle VirtualBox、Microsoft Hyper-V等
它们各有千秋,但基本功能相似,都能满足在虚拟机中安装Windows XP的需求
以下是几款主流虚拟机软件的简要对比: - VMware Workstation:功能强大,支持广泛的操作系统和硬件兼容性,适合专业用户和开发者使用
提供高级功能如虚拟机网络桥接、快照管理等
- Oracle VirtualBox:开源免费,易于安装和使用,适合个人用户和小型团队
支持基本虚拟机管理功能,如快照、克隆等,且对资源占用相对较低
- Microsoft Hyper-V:集成于Windows Server和Windows 10/11 Pro及以上版本中,专为服务器虚拟化设计,但同样适用于桌面环境
提供高效的虚拟化解决方案,且与Windows系统深度集成
三、在虚拟机中安装Windows XP的步骤 以下以Oracle VirtualBox为例,详细介绍在虚拟机中安装Windows XP的步骤: 1.下载并安装VirtualBox: - 访问Oracle VirtualBox官方网站,下载适用于你操作系统的最新版本的VirtualBox安装包
- 按照提示完成安装过程
2.创建虚拟机: - 打开VirtualBox,点击“新建”按钮
- 输入虚拟机名称(如“Windows XP”),选择操作系统类型和版本(选择“Microsoft Windows”和“Windows XP”)
- 分配内存大小,一般建议至少分配512MB内存给Windows XP虚拟机
- 创建虚拟硬盘,选择动态分配或固定大小,并设置硬盘大小(建议至少分配20GB)
3.配置虚拟机设置: - 在虚拟机设置窗口中,可以进一步调整CPU核心数、显存大小、网络适配器类型等配置
- 确保网络适配器设置为“桥接网络”或“NAT网络”,以便虚拟机能够访问外部网络
4.安装Windows XP: - 将Windows XP安装光盘镜像(ISO文件)加载到虚拟机中
可以通过虚拟机设置中的“存储”选项卡,添加一个光驱设备,并选择ISO文件作为光盘镜像
- 启动虚拟机,按照屏幕提示进行Windows XP的安装过程
- 安装过程中,可能需要输入一些基本信息,如序列号、时区、管理员密码等
5.安装虚拟机增强工具: - Windows XP安装完成后,打开虚拟机窗口的“设备”菜单,选择“安装增强功能”
这将安装一套用于提升虚拟机性能和兼容性的驱动程序和工具
- 重启虚拟机,使增强功能生效
6.更新与配置: - 虽然Windows XP已停止官方支持,但建议通过第三方途径(如Windows Update Archive)安装重要的安全更新和补丁,以增强系统安全性
- 根据需求,安装必要的软件和驱动程序,配置网络连接、打印机等外设
四、注意事项 1.合法性与许可证:确保你拥有合法有效的Windows XP许可证,以及虚拟机软件的授权
2.性能优化:根据物理机的硬件配置,适当调整虚拟机资源分配,以达到最佳性能表现
3.安全性考虑:虽然虚拟机提供了隔离性,但仍需保持警惕,避免在虚拟机中执行不可信的程序或文件
4.备份与恢复:定期使用虚拟机软件的快照功能备份虚拟机状态,以便在出现问题时能够快速恢复
五、结语 在虚拟机中安装Windows XP,不仅解决了老旧软件、游戏的兼容性问题,还充分利用了现有硬件资源,提高了系统的灵活性和安全性
通过合理选择虚拟机软件、细致配置虚拟机参数,我们可以轻松搭建起一个既稳定又高效的Windows XP虚拟环境,满足多样化的应用需求
随着虚拟化技术的不断发展,虚拟机将在更多领域发挥重要作用,成为连接过去与未来的桥梁